基于JAVA和SQL SERVER的学生数据管理系统设计
56 浏览量
更新于2024-06-24
收藏 3.4MB DOC 举报
"这篇学士学位论文探讨了教学管理系统中的学生数据管理子系统,由西安科技大学高新学院的计算机科学与技术专业的学生进行设计和撰写。论文的目的是通过使用JAVA和SQL SERVER来理解和实践网络数据库管理系统的开发,同时验证关系数据库的理论知识。设计任务涵盖了局域网建设、JAVA数据库开发、SQL SERVER的数据库管理和编程等方面,最终目标是构建一个能够管理学生数据并生成教学相关报表的系统。"
这篇论文详细阐述了如何设计和实现一个基于网络的教学管理系统的学生数据管理子系统。学生在设计过程中将学习到的主要知识点包括:
1. **局域网建设**:了解和实践局域网的基本构造和配置,包括网络设备的连接、IP地址的分配和网络通信的设置。
2. **JAVA数据库开发**:使用JAVA作为主要编程语言,学习如何与数据库进行交互,包括建立连接、执行SQL语句、处理结果集等,以此实现数据的增删查改功能。
3. **SQL SERVER数据库管理**:掌握SQL SERVER数据库的创建、表的设计、存储过程的编写以及数据库关系的建立。理解关系数据库模型和其在实际应用中的作用。
4. **数据库操作**:通过SQL SERVER客户端进行数据库的日常管理,包括数据导入导出、备份恢复、性能优化等,确保数据的安全性和高效性。
5. **JAVA数据库编程**:深入学习JDBC(Java Database Connectivity),掌握如何在JAVA程序中进行数据库操作,包括连接池的使用、事务处理和异常处理。
6. **系统设计与实现**:构建一个完整的教学管理系统,其中学生数据管理子系统需具备录入、查询、更新和删除学生信息的功能,并能生成如成绩表、考勤表等教学管理所需的各种报表。
7. **项目管理与文档编写**:了解毕业设计或论文的规范,如任务书的填写要求,以及参考文献的引用格式,提升项目文档的标准化和专业化。
整个设计过程强调理论与实践相结合,旨在提高学生的实际操作能力和问题解决能力,同时加深对计算机科学与技术,尤其是数据库管理领域的理解。通过这个项目,学生将能够具备开发和维护实际数据库系统的能力,为未来职业生涯打下坚实基础。
2023-06-30 上传
2023-07-10 上传
2023-06-30 上传
2023-07-09 上传
2023-06-30 上传
2023-07-02 上传
zzzzl333
- 粉丝: 783
- 资源: 7万+
最新资源
- 深入浅出:自定义 Grunt 任务的实践指南
- 网络物理突变工具的多点路径规划实现与分析
- multifeed: 实现多作者间的超核心共享与同步技术
- C++商品交易系统实习项目详细要求
- macOS系统Python模块whl包安装教程
- 掌握fullstackJS:构建React框架与快速开发应用
- React-Purify: 实现React组件纯净方法的工具介绍
- deck.js:构建现代HTML演示的JavaScript库
- nunn:现代C++17实现的机器学习库开源项目
- Python安装包 Acquisition-4.12-cp35-cp35m-win_amd64.whl.zip 使用说明
- Amaranthus-tuberculatus基因组分析脚本集
- Ubuntu 12.04下Realtek RTL8821AE驱动的向后移植指南
- 掌握Jest环境下的最新jsdom功能
- CAGI Toolkit:开源Asterisk PBX的AGI应用开发
- MyDropDemo: 体验QGraphicsView的拖放功能
- 远程FPGA平台上的Quartus II17.1 LCD色块闪烁现象解析